We had something similar happen in Tunisia in 2002. The reliance on diesel turbines meant a very long rebooting process. As a result, the government invested heavily in installing gas turbines all over the country. When we had another blackout event in 2018(?), it only took an hour or so to get things back again.

Why is that? Are turbines easier to speed regulate than diesel engines?

Yes, the huge rotating mass is inherently more stable than a diesel. They key to grid stability is mostly huge rotating mass, either producing or consuming.

Spain is mostly back up. Plant startup is only the first step.[1] It's load pickup. Here is a PJM training module on load pickup during system restoration.[2] It gives a sense of how touchy the process is. Power network control has good control over generation and transmission, but limited control over load. When load is turned on, there are transient loads with different time constants. There's a huge load for the f…

The groundwork for the blackout will inevitably come back to a buildout and reliance of renewable sources that do not have spinning mass that can do frequency synchronization.

There are costly means to compensate for the lack of spinning baseload but actually building these devices have been neglected, to no ones surprise.

I have no idea how much power an EUV source consumes, but I’m surprised to hear that it’s more than a handful of kW. What’s the right ballpark?

ASML says 1.3 MW for a single system. So off by three orders of magnitude.
